Many teams made last minute trades as QMJHL deadline loomed

Press Release

Many teams took advantage of the trade period which ended today at noon, to make changes to their rosters.

Among today trades, the Chicoutimi Saguenéens’ sent Charles Hudon to the Baie-Comeau Drakkar in exchange for the third round pick of 2014, and first round picks of 2015, 2016 and 2017.

Dominic Talbot-Tassi, the Sherbrooke Phoenix defenceman, was traded along with a first round pick for 2015 to the Blainville-Boisbriand Armada in exchange for Julien Bahl. Both teams play against each other tomorrow in Sherbrooke. The Phoenix also sent Jean-François Plante and a fifth round pick of 2015 to the Victoriaville Tigres in exchange for the second pick of 2014 and third pick of 2015.

The Cap-Breton Screaming Eagles traded William Carrier and Matthew Donnelly to the Drummondville Voltigeurs in exchange for Guillaume Gauthier as well as a fifth round pick of 2014 and first round pick of 2015.

The Charlottetown Islanders sent Alexis Pépin to the Gatineau Olympiques, Jack Nevins to the Rouyn-Noranda Huskies and Ryan Graves to the Val-d’Or Foreur and welcomed David Henley,, Vladislav Lysenko, Julien Avon and Curtis Scale.
